Title: Systems for electronic support of the educational process as a behavioural analyst
Keywords: electronic education, management, internet, behaviour.

Abstract: This paper discusses the application of e-learning systems as a tool for indirect survey. Different modules from the electronic systems used at the Technical University of Sofia for control and assessment of the educational process are presented. The possibilities to summarise data from the application of the electronic means for education as a tool for assessing the behaviour of students are presented. Practical results from such studies are shown.
